The sixth edition, published by Prentice Hall, specifically aimed to make students aware of the global environmental changes of the 1990s, showing how effective managers could adapt to a rapidly changing world.

Stoner's management approach is based on the contingency theory, which suggests that the effectiveness of a management approach depends on various situational factors, such as the organization, its environment, and its goals.
The text is known for its theme, which emphasizes the rapid changes in modern business and what future managers need to succeed. It balances classical management theories—such as planning, organizing, leading, and controlling—with contemporary issues like ethics, globalization, and diversity. Key Features
